Merridale Street West - Temporary Prohibition Of Traffic
What is happening?
THE WOLVERHAMPTON CITY COUNCIL
(MERRIDALE STREET WEST) (TEMPORARY
PROHIBITION OF TRAFFIC) ORDER 2026
N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N that the Wolverhampton City
Council propose to make an Order under Section 14(1)(a)
of the Road Traffic Regulation Act 1984, as substituted by
the Road Traffic (Temporary Restrictions) Act 1991,
prohibiting vehicles from proceeding on the following
stretches of road:
l Merridale Street West closed from opposite property 2 to
its junction with Zoar Street. It is anticipated that the
closure will operate from 3 August 2026 until
3 February 2028.
l 3 way lights on Zoar Street from its junction with
Merridale Street West, in place between 3 August 2026
and 12 August 2026 only.
The Order may operate for a maximum period of eighteen
months, but it is anticipated that the works will be
undertaken between the dates specified above.
The diversion route is: Upper Zoar Street, Lea Road,
Bristol Street, Ashland Street and vice versa.
The Order is required to facilitate demolition and
redevelopment works by Keon Homes.
